Elliott hoping for better from Delta in Savills Chase

Gordon Elliott is hoping for a much better showing from Delta Work when he lines up in the Savills Chase at Leopardstown on Saturday week.

The Gigginstown gelding proved one of the top novices last season when registering three Grade 1 victories.

He was below par on his return in the Ladbrokes Champion Chase at Down Royal early last month, however, when finishing fourth behind Road To Respect.

Elliott has revealed that he returned home lame after that run and expects him to leave it well behind.

“He worked at Naas on Wednesday morning and the plan is to go for the Savills Chase.

“He's better than he showed at Down Royal. He came home lame after it, we have him back sound now and he's working well so we're looking forward to running him.”

Elliott plans to have plenty of runners over the festive period and outlined plans for some of his other stars:-

“Battleoverdoyen will go for the three-mile, Abacadabras will run in the two-mile novice while Samcro will probably go to Limerick for the two-mile-three novice chase.

“Coeur Sublime will run in the Grade 1 (December Hurdle). It was the plan to go straight to Leopardstown. He's in good form and worked well on Wednesday morning at Naas, we're looking forward to running him."
